What is an EHS Site Manager?

An EHS Site Manager is a crucial role responsible for ensuring Environment, Health, and Safety (EHS) regulations are adhered to at a particular site.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

  • What are the roles and responsibilities of an EHS Site Manager?question toggle

    An EHS Site Manager ensures compliance with environment, health, and safety regulations at a facility. They oversee safety training, emergency preparations, and the disposal of hazardous waste.

  • What qualifications are necessary for an EHS Site Manager Position?question toggle

    Typically, a bachelor's degree in Environmental Health and Safety or a related field is required. Some roles may require professional certifications and several years of relevant experience.
